FAMILY IN SERIOUS CONDITION FOLLOWING SINGLE VEHICLE CRASH
A mother and her two children are being treated at John Hunter Hospital after their vehicle ran off the road and hit a tree on Nowendoc Road, Mount Gorge, west of Taree.
The family were trapped in the vehicle when emergency services arrived just after 6:30pm last night.
Once released from the wreckage a 6 year old girl was treated for a serious head injury and placed onto Life Support by the Rescue Helicopters, Critical Care Medical Team.
Her 11 year old sister was treated and stabilised for serious leg and chest injuries.
Both were flown to John Hunter Hospital, Newcastle.
A second Rescue Helicopter later transported the 30-year-old female suffering serious leg and arm injuries.
